For those who’re aware of Website positioning, you realize that backlinks are A necessary Element of any successful Website. Specifically, Internet two.0 backlinks have gained acceptance due to their capability to improve search engine rankings and travel a lot more natural and organic traffic. A Biased View of Blog https://www.seobyaxy.com/product-category/seo-services/